Works of calligrapher Huang Yongsheng

Calligrapher Huang Yongsheng's works are blue and white splash-ink landscapes.

Huang Yongsheng's porcelain paintings are rich in themes, involving landscapes and figures, mainly landscapes. The picture of the work is smart, hazy, realistic and dreamy. Freehand brushwork is smudged with big splash ink, and the details reflect the characters' demeanor and carefully depict every grass and tree. Characters' works are full of life interest and humanistic feelings, which profoundly show the ideological realm and spiritual pursuit when creating.

His works are bold and delicate, and he constantly pursues artistic innovation. The quaint artistic creation has always been the attitude of porcelain painting. As a young artist, Huang Yongsheng's works of art have richer themes, such as the waves of the Yellow River, the desolation of the desert, the misty rain along the river, the emptiness at the top of the mountain and the emerald green of Shan Lan.

Huang Yongsheng related introduction

Huang Yongsheng is a powerful young artist with profound artistic foundation. Due to family inheritance and artistic edification, he was deeply impressed by porcelain painting since he was a child. He has a solid artistic foundation, is guided by famous teachers, is modest and low-key, and focuses on the pursuit and enthusiasm of ceramic art.

Blue and white splash-ink landscape is the representative of Jingdezhen ceramic art, and Huang Yongsheng's porcelain plate painting has formed its own artistic style on the basis of inheriting the tradition. It uses embryo as paper, uses Chinese painting techniques to express ink painting heartily, and at the same time has unique personal charm, which fully shows the artist's aesthetic taste and feelings when creating. The works are fresh and unique, paying attention to composition, wrinkle, artistic conception and arrangement of levels.
